Как сделать надстройку Powerpoint доступной в версиях Powerpoint 2016+: для настольных ПК, онлайн и Mac - PullRequest
0 голосов
/ 24 марта 2020

Я создаю надстройку PowerPoint, используя Powrpoint JS API. Поскольку в этой надстройке используются методы, недоступные в PowerPoint 2013, я хочу обновить элемент Наборы требований внутри манифеста, чтобы сделать его доступным в версии Powerpoint 2016+ и Office Online

Я проверяю манифест "npx office- addin-manifest validate ", и я не получаю желаемых результатов. После того, как я попробую это:

<Requirements>
   <Sets DefaultMinVersion="1.1">
       <Set Name="PowerPointApi" MinVersion="1.1"/>
   </Sets>
 </Requirements>

Я получаю этот результат после проверки:

На основании требований, указанных в вашем манифесте, ваше дополнение может работать на следующих платформах: -PowerPoint для Ipad - PowerPoint 2016 для Mac - PowerPoint Online

Таким образом, он доступен в Powerpoint 2016, но не доступен в Office для Windows P C Dekstop Powerpoint. Метод, который не поддерживается в Powerpoint 2013, это метод PowerPoint.createPresentation ().

, поэтому желаемый результат - запустить его на следующих платформах:

-PowerPoint для Ipad

-PowerPoint 2016 для Ma c

-PowerPoint Online

+ PowerPoint 2016+ для Windows P C

...